Commercial Exterior Painting in Clearwater, FL
Commercial exterior painting services encompass the application of high-quality paint and finishes to the exterior surfaces of commercial properties, including storefronts, office buildings, warehouses, and other business structures. This service aims to enhance curb appeal, provide protection against weather and environmental elements, and extend the lifespan of building exteriors. Projects can range from small touch-ups to large-scale repainting efforts, often involving surface preparation, such as cleaning, sanding, and repairs, to ensure a durable and smooth finish.

Common Commercial Exterior Painting Jobs
Commercial building exteriors - includes painting walls, trim, and architectural features to enhance curb appeal.
Office complex facades - involves refreshing the exterior surfaces of multi-unit office buildings.
Retail storefronts - focuses on brightening and protecting storefronts to attract customers.
Industrial facility exteriors - provides durable coatings for warehouses and manufacturing plants.
Apartment complex exteriors - involves painting multiple units and common areas for a uniform look.
Parking garages and structures - includes coating surfaces to improve safety and longevity.
Commercial Exterior Painting Questions
What types of commercial buildings can benefit from exterior painting? Exterior painting is suitable for a variety of commercial properties including office buildings, retail stores, warehouses, and industrial facilities to improve appearance and protect surfaces.
How often should exterior painting be considered for commercial properties? Typically, exterior surfaces should be evaluated every 5 to 10 years to maintain their appearance and durability, depending on exposure and material type.
What surfaces are commonly painted on commercial exteriors? Common surfaces include stucco, brick, metal siding, wood, and concrete, all of which can be refreshed with appropriate exterior paints.
What should property owners know before starting exterior painting? Proper surface preparation, including cleaning and repairs, is essential for a quality finish and long-lasting results on commercial exteriors.
